The video discusses the agency or service-selling business model, highlighting its high profit margins of 60-70%. It outlines five key elements for success, including solving real problems, productizing services, ensuring stable monthly income, creating scalable systems, and maintaining personal involvement in all projects.
Agency or service selling is the easiest business to start, with margins typically 60-70%. Examples include marketing, programming, design, or AI services.
First key element: solve a real, pressing, and painful problem for many clients.
Second key element: transform the service into a product—productively offer your own service.
Third key element: generate stable monthly income via subscriptions (monthly, quarterly, or annual).
Fourth key element: establish a system for expansion with clear procedures and a work manual.
Fifth key element: personally be involved in every project and know all clients daily, regardless of team size.
